What's the ground like? If that's sodden now, probably best to leave it and deal with it in the spring, when the ground is more firm.
Is it fenced? Grazing with cattle is always good for getting on top of longer grass, provided the ground can take their feet.
If you mow it, can you get it baled and wrapped, and use or sell it? Otherwise would suggest you not mow it but, if you do anything now, top it with a flail topper, which leaves a mulch that will put nutrients back into the ground. Mowing and leaving cut long grass to rot will give you more problems than leaving it as is.
